US woos India to join ‘NATO Plus’ ahead of Modi-Biden meeting, harms New Delhi’s strategic autonomy
The US has stepped up efforts to woo India ahead of Indian Prime Minister Narendra Modi's visit to Washington, with its envoy to India recently hailing New Delhi as "one…